ORDINANCE REPEALING CHAPTER 27 OF THE CODE OF THE CITY OF REDWOOD CITY AND ADDING CHAPTER 27 TO THE CODE OF THE CITY OF REDWOOD CITY, RELATING TO THE REGULATION OF SANITARY SEWERAGE AND STORM WATER DRAINAGE FACILITIES THE COUNCIL OF REDWOOD CITY DOES 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S: SECTION 1. Chapter 27 of the Code of the City of Redwood City, as amended, entitled "Sanitary Sewerage and Storm Water Drainage Facilities", is hereby repealed. SECTION 2. Chapter 27 is hereby added to the Code of the City of Redwood City to read as follows: "CHAPTER 27
